3000psi oxygen has to be treated with great respect. Normal greases can flash and burn with the heat created when it flows at that pressure. I have a tube of that at work.

Something I've never forgotten: when I was a youngster, I was able to take some courses at Delaware State Fire School. In a Hazardous Materials class, the instructor filled a jar with pure oxygen. He then held a lit cigarette in the jar (with tongs). The cigarette flashed into brilliant white flame, almost too bright to look at, and then was ash.
